Abstract:
Disclosed is a method for the formation of multi-layer paint films with the omission of a mid-coat paint coating process. The method comprises the use of a particular aqueous colored paint (A) comprising a prescribed amount of specified titanium oxide that has been compounded, The resulting multi-layer paint films have a very bright paint color, and especially a white or light-colored color, and have excellent concealing properties. The aqueous colored paint (A) is characterized by containing from 50 to 60 mass % with respect to the whole paint solid fraction of titanium oxide of specific surface area not more than 13 m2/g.
Abstract:
To provide a waterborne mid-coat paint composition for obtaining paint films which have an outstanding painting performance (particularly in terms of sagging resistance) and are smooth and give a high- quality appearance. [Solution Means] A waterborne mid-coat paint composition which contains, as indispensible components, (A) a water-soluble or water-dispersible polyester resin, (B) a melamine resin, and (C) polypropylene glycol, where said component (A) is a polyester resin which has been rendered waterborne by adding 7-20 mass%, based on the resin solids content of component (A), of (a) a C1-3 alkoxy group-containing glycol monoalkyl ether to a polyester resin of resin acid value 25-35 mgKOH/g and then neutralizing with a secondary amine and/or tertiary amine, and said component (B) comprises a methylated melamine resin and a methyl/butyl mixed alkylated melamine resin, and the content ratio based on resin solids content by mass of the methylated melamine resin to the methyl/butyl mixed alkylated melamine resin is from 50/50 to 90/10, and the content ratio based on resin solids content by mass of component (A) to component (B) is from 70/30 to 90/10, and said component (C) has a number average molecular weight of between 400 and 1,200, and the content of component (C) by mass percentage is between 1 and 10 mass% in terms of the combined resin solids contents by mass of component (A) and component (B).
Abstract:
A resin composition comprises (A) hydroxyl group containing acrylic resin having a hydroxyl group value of from 5 to 200 mgKOH/g and a number average molecular weight of from 500 to 20,000, (B) hexakisalkoxymethylated melamine resin, (C) de-watering agent, (D) blocked sulfonic acid compound, (E) silicate compound and (F) at least one type of material selected from among (a) organic resin particle of average particle diameter not more than 40 μm, (b) inorganic glass particles of average particle diameter not more than 100 μm and (c) inorganic fibers of average length not more than 300 μm.
